 Four people from Donald Trump's team in the White House have resigned immediately after the assault on the Capitol. They are White House Deputy Speaker Sarah Matthews, First Lady Melania Trump's Chief of Staff, Stephanie Grisham, White House Head of Social Events Anna Cristina Nicet, and the Deputy National Security Counselor of the White House, Matt Pottinger. "It has been an honor to serve my country in the White House. I am very proud to have been part of First Lady Melania Trump's mission to help children and the accomplishments of this Administration," said Stephanie Grisham.


A gesture that many interpret as support for Donald Trump's wife who is in the spotlight for several reasons. The future is uncertain, both due to the drift of events - which has led to the talk of dismissal - and the intense rumors of divorce that the American social press does not stop feeding.

Her real name is Melania Knauss. She grew up in a modest apartment in a town near Sevnica (Slovenia), which was then part of the Socialist Federal Republic of Yugoslavia (FSYR), dissolved in 1992 with the Balkan War. After starting her modeling career in Milan and Paris, she moved to New York in 1996. Five years later she obtained her permanent residence and in 2006 she became a naturalized American.


She is extremely careful when discussing her married life with Trump. They met at a party during New York Fashion Week. It was 1998 and they were married 7 years later. "We are both very independent. I let him be who he is and he lets me be who I am. I'm not trying to change him, he's an adult," she once said on CNN.
